Javascript 与addEventListener一起发出
创建addEventListener时出错Javascript 与addEventListener一起发出,javascript,node.js,reactjs,jsx,Javascript,Node.js,Reactjs,Jsx,创建addEventListener时出错 inviteButton = document.querySelector(".add-invite"); inviteButton.addEventListener("click", (e)=>{ addEmail(); }); ./src/components/form/invests.js 第24行:分析错误:意外令牌 22 | }; 23 | inviteButton = document.querySe
inviteButton = document.querySelector(".add-invite");
inviteButton.addEventListener("click", (e)=>{
addEmail();
});
./src/components/form/invests.js
第24行:分析错误:意外令牌
22 | };
23 | inviteButton = document.querySelector(".add-invite");
> 24 | inviteButton.addEventListener("click", (e)=>{
| ^
25 | addEmail();
26 | });
27 |
感谢您的帮助您在哪里执行它?您的环境不支持ES6,请尝试此方法
inviteButton.addEventListener("click", function (e) {
addEmail();
});
我假设您的querySelector返回null,并且没有找到导致addEventListener函数不可用的元素
你能检查一下“addinvite”类是否真的出现在你的页面上,或者发布更多的代码吗 如果它不支持ES6,那么它将在arrow函数上出错,而不是在有效ES5的部分上。如果它返回
null
错误消息将是“无法访问null的属性”而不是“意外标记”的内容,注释不用于扩展讨论;这段对话已经结束。